Hakuba 47 Winter Sports Park
Skiing/Snowboarding Area
This ski resort in the Hakuba area is known for a regular amount of snowfall of superb quality. Consisting of eight routes, half pipes, and a kids slope. It connects with Hakuba Goryu at the summit, and you can come and go between them with the same lift pass. The Route 3 course in front of the gondola station at the summit is an action-packed run where moguls have been left the entire way. Hakuba 47’s hallmark Route 1 run also comes highly recommended. It’s the first slope groomed in the morning, and you can enjoy great scenery while skiing down towards the village of Hakuba.
